I ask the Taoiseach to clarify the position regarding the property tax. He mentioned previously that the legislation would be published on budget day. Is that still the case? I also ask him to update us on the health amendment Bill, which proposes to provide free GP services. When is it likely to be published and debated in the Dáil? The programme for Government committed to providing free GP care for claimants under the long-term illness scheme in the first year of Government but we are already nine months behind that target. When will it be delivered and what is causing the delay?

I welcome the publication yesterday of the report of the expert group on the judgment in A, B and C v. Ireland. I ask the Taoiseach to indicate whether the report will be debated in the Dáil next Tuesday and on another day next week. I suggest, given the importance of the issue and also the fact that we will have the budget next week, which should dominate discussions here, that he convene the Parliament on Monday. Sinn Féin would be happy to facilitate that so that we can have a dedicated discussion on the expert group report on Monday and Tuesday, because the rest of the week will be taken up with budgetary matters, as will much of the following week. I urge the Taoiseach to consider convening the Parliament on Monday so that we can discuss the report properly.
